Set in a vast underground city, cast to ruins by a catastrophic earthquake. The D'ni once lived here, the center of a vast network of worlds Written and called into being by the D'ni Guilds.

Why are you here? Well, because you found a linking book and touched it, causing you to be immediately dragged into the ruins of this city. Even though the D'ni are gone, their craft lives on. And a handful of them live on, eking out a living between cracked stones and old, splendorous buildings.

Anyone could go home -- but only if they could find the original Book that created their own universe. And, unfortunately, most of the city is made up of libraries, and Books could be found in private residences, or businesses, or collections, or anywhere. It could take decades to search them all, and then a linking book to your world would have to be written. And god forbid you'd find the Book and realize that it has been altered from what you knew it to be.

Characters would live in the ancient city of D'ni, and travel back and forth between all discovered universes in the library. They would even be able to learn how to write worlds themselves. Beyond the quest for getting home, they would have to solve the puzzle of why the D'ni fell in the first place and what's wrong with all the worlds out there.

Basically I'm thinking panfandom, accepts all kinds of characters, OCs and AUs, because the premise really allows for it. Probably very unrestrictive gameplay, a lot of freedom for characters to travel to other worlds and play with things.

how about a memory loss game

where the characters are forcibly dragged into another world by two warring factions of dickheads who need cannon fodder

as soon as the characters arrive, the two factions each steal half of the characters' memories as leverage

then both factions try to get the characters on their sides with each promising to return a) the memories they've got, and b) the memories they'll pull from the cold dead hands of the other guys ... once they win, of course.

thus leaving the characters to decide whether they want to join the shitheads or the douchebags, knowing only their own names, basic personalities, and the gaping emptiness where their entire lives used to be

they'd get to earn back random memories through missions, foraging, killing enemy factioners, and so on. things could be adapted to suit characters' skill sets, no use in wasting resources

the war would be the main overarching plot but there would be handfuls of smaller events and possible plot twists along the way
